[AsburyPark] Correction Re: State Inspections
Thank you Werner - we are both kind of right and wrong... See the exceptions which should be eliminated anyway. If one unit is owner occupied, then they change. It was 1-4 as a rule. Better to own a 3 family or less, then you avoid the mess. The real issue is landlords and all property owners having a stake in their surroundings. -- Exceptions Condominiums, Cooperatives, Mutual Housing Corporations. Though the Hotel and Multiple Dwelling Law provides that multiple dwelling buildings having a condominium or cooperative or mutual housing corporation form of ownership are under the Bureau's jurisdiction, the law also exempts sections of such buildings that: 1) contain not more than four dwelling units, 2) have at least two exterior walls unattached to any adjoining building section and where attached, are attached exclusively by fire-resistant rated walls, and 3) contain dwelling units that are owner-occupied (if both owner- and non-owner-occupied units are contained therein, only the owner-occupied units are exempt). --- In AsburyPark@yahoogroups.com, wernerapnj wernerapnj@... wrote: Oak, State registration and inspection is required for buildings with 3 or more units. On the issue of landlords in the city (and state) - consider that many of these homes are rent subsidized - meaning that that are SUPPOSED to be inspected by: The funding source's inspectors YEARLY - if state Section 8 - then Monmouth County inspects yearly - if another Housing authority voucher, say middletown or long branch, then they schlep to AP and perform an inspection - yearly. - if emergency housing voucher from county, then m county, different division. ONE TIME INSPECTION - prior to issuing a CO (Certificate of Occupancy) - city code or health inspection - city FD (Not sure if AP combined this to one) Most towns require an inspection by Fire and Code/Health dept for a CO - along with complete paperwork. ADDITIONALLY: - STATE INSPECTIONS required for over 4 units The general rule for inspections fall under the HOUSING QUALITY STANDARDS (HQS) created by HUD as a guideline for inspectors. Found on my website: http://www.rentlaw.com/section8/hqs.htm Or on the HUD website. As a landlord - I've failed for such things as closet door floor bracket cracked cause the tenant stuffed the closet causing the bracket to break or tenant's garbage piled 4' deep in the basement ,,, or missing smoke detectors / light bulbs etc - things that don't normally go missing if your own home.
